Book Description

July 1992 World Religions and Ecology
Each book in the "World Religions and Ecology" series deals with the teachings, beliefs, history and present-day attitudes and contribution of a particular faith to the environment. The books cover several areas: teachings and traditions, environmental practice and responding to the crisis. Under teachings and traditions the books look at core ideas and beliefs as found within the faith's main scriptures and traditional teachings. They also include studies of historical turning points in the faith's teachings about the environment. Under environmental practice, the books examine the practices and ways of life arising from the teachings outlined in the first section and their impact (negative and positive) on the environment. The final section, responding to the crisis, looks at how the faith is rethinking or re-examining its teachings and practices in the light of the ecological crisis. What does the faith believe to be the most important insights it has to bring to the debate about the future? What are the faith's hopes for the future? This section also contains case studies of practical action to protect the environment undertaken as an expression of faith. Through a series of stories, examples, teachings from sacred texts, illustrations, interviews with Hindus involved with ecology and descriptions of current projects, this study demonstrates how humanity's role in preserving the environment is a central theme of Hinduism.

About the Author

Ranchor Prime worked as an environmental project manager in Britain and India, and has published ten books on Hindu spirituality and ecology. His books include Ramayan, A Journey, 1997, and Bhagavad Gita, 2003. He lives in London and is a regular broadcaster and public speaker. --This text refers to an out of print or unavailable edition of this title.
